June Meeting Report

Saturday, June 27th, 2009

Radnage W.I’.s June Meeting was rather a departure from the norm. We held our meeting, ( in tandem with “The Ridge Evening” W.I.) on a canal boat on the Grand Union Canal. The evening cruise was most relaxing, the weather good and the fish and chip supper excellent. It was very interesting to see the wildlife on the river, (mostly birds, Herons, Grey Wagtails, Moor Hens, Coots etc.) and also to see what would be familiar countryside from a very different perspective, not to mention the historical significance of the whole canal concept, now sadly used only for leisure purposes. The Victorians who masterminded the system would have turned in their graves if they saw the lack of industrial enterprise .!! A very relaxing and interesting evening was had by all.

Radnage W.I.’s April meeting was held as usual in Radnage Village Hall.

Our Speaker Sylvia and her husband are speakers for the Hearing dogs for Deaf People charity. They had brought along their current charge, Ivy, a small, black and very cute hearing dog which they were “socialising” during her training. Ivy spent a lot of the meeting asleep on the lap of one of our members who also has hearing dogs during training, when not asleep she kept a very close eye on the canines on the recreation field, taking their owners out for an evening stroll. She made it quite clear that she wanted to join in. The talk was about the work of the charity and the dogs, and provoked many questions.
